In November, Stéphane de Gélis (photo) will take over the general management of Lacaux, which belongs to the French group CGW Packaging. He will succeed Denis Boudenne, who will retire. Like his predecessor, Stéphane de Gélis will also supervise the cardboard plants (EDC Transmouss, Carton plus, Cartonnerie de l’Espérance and Cartonnages Champenois). At the helm of Papeteries de Condat (Lecta Group) since 2018, Stéphane de Gélis has successfully turned around and modified this site while engaging in an energy transformation. Hubert-Florian Cutillas, who until now ran two Glatfelter sites in England, will succeed him as Condat mill director.
